A curated catalog of 300+ battle-tested Terraform/OpenTofu IaC modules to quickly and reliably deploy and manage AWS infrastructure.
Vendor
Gruntwork
Company Website


Gruntwork IaC Library provides a comprehensive and proven catalog of over 300 infrastructure-as-code modules using Terraform and OpenTofu. These modules are designed to set up, deploy, and manage foundational and application-related AWS infrastructure components efficiently. Built from extensive real-world experience and tested rigorously, the modules cover a wide range of AWS services including networking, compute, storage, security, and observability. The library empowers developers to scaffold infrastructure quickly, combining reusable modules that follow best practices and enterprise-grade standards. It integrates seamlessly with the Terragrunt toolset and supports creating private module catalogs tailored to organizational needs. This solution simplifies infrastructure deployment, reduces operational risk, and accelerates cloud adoption.
Key Features
Battle-tested Modules A comprehensive catalog of over 300 carefully designed Terraform/OpenTofu modules proven in production.
- Covers foundational AWS services such as VPC, IAM, SSO, and GuardDuty
- Includes application infrastructure like EKS, ECS, Lambda, databases, and more
- Modules comply with CIS AWS Foundations Benchmark by default
Automated Testing & Reliability Every module is subjected to extensive automated unit and integration testing using Terratest.
- Ensures stability and reliability before deployment
- Continuous validation of every commit to maintain code quality
Modular & Extendable Combine and customize modules to build a private catalog tailored to company-specific requirements.
- Organize approved modules in git repos for developer clarity
- Create templates and scaffold new infrastructure quickly with provided tooling
Developer Empowerment & Productivity
Tools such as terragrunt catalog
and terragrunt scaffold
enable developers to browse modules and generate code easily.
- Simplifies discovery and usage of approved infrastructure components
- Speeds up infrastructure deployment via reusable templates and examples
Wide AWS Service Coverage Modules cover a broad spectrum of AWS including networking, compute, storage, security, databases, observability, and more.
- Networking: VPC, Transit Gateway, Route 53, CloudFront
- Compute: EC2, Auto Scaling, ECS, EKS, Lambda, Fargate
- Storage: S3, EBS, EFS, ECR
- Security & Compliance: IAM, GuardDuty, CloudTrail, Macie
- Databases: MySQL, Postgres, Aurora, Redis, Memcached
- Observability: Metrics, Logs, Dashboards, Alerts
Benefits
Accelerated Infrastructure Deployment Reduces time to launch AWS infrastructure from weeks or months to minutes or hours.
- Avoid reinventing core infrastructure modules
- Quickly scaffold and deploy infrastructure components with minimal manual effort
Consistency and Best Practices Modules encapsulate proven enterprise-grade architecture and security standards.
- Reduces configuration errors and security risks
- Ensures compliance with industry benchmarks out of the box
Improved Developer Experience Enables developers to focus on application logic rather than infrastructure plumbing.
- Provides easy-to-use tools for discovering and scaffolding infrastructure
- Facilitates standardization across teams with approved module catalogs
Cost-Effective and Scalable Pay-as-you-go, month-to-month contracts with discounted annual plans available.
- Supports scaling infrastructure management as the organization grows
- Seamless integration with other Gruntwork products for extended capabilities